Overview
The MKV30F128VLH10 is a 32-bit microcontroller from NXP USA Inc., part of the Kinetis KV series. It is based on the Arm Cortex-M4 core and is designed for a wide range of applications requiring high performance and low power consumption. This microcontroller is particularly suited for industrial, automotive, and IoT sectors due to its robust feature set and scalability.
Key Specifications
Parameter | Value |
---|---|
Core Type | Arm Cortex-M4 |
Operating Frequency [Max] | 100 MHz |
Flash Memory | 128 KB |
SRAM | 16 KB |
Package Type | 64-LQFP (10x10x1.6mm) |
Number of I/Os | 46 |
Supply Voltage | 1.71V to 3.6V |
Operating Temperature | -40°C to 105°C |
Peripherals | DMA, PWM, WDT, I²C, SPI, UART/USART, SAR ADC x2, Timers x2 (6ch) |
Key Features
- High Performance Core: The MKV30F128VLH10 features an Arm Cortex-M4 core with a floating-point unit (FPU), enabling efficient processing of complex algorithms.
- Memory and Storage: It includes 128 KB of flash memory and 16 KB of SRAM, providing ample space for code and data storage.
- Peripheral Set: The microcontroller is equipped with a variety of peripherals such as DMA, PWM, WDT, I²C, SPI, UART/USART, and SAR ADCs, making it versatile for various applications.
- Low Power Consumption: Designed with low power consumption in mind, it is suitable for battery-powered devices and applications requiring extended battery life.
- Robust Clock System: The device features a robust clock system with internal oscillators and a low-leakage wakeup locked loop reference, ensuring reliable timing and clock management.
Applications
- Industrial Automation: Suitable for industrial control systems, motor control, and sensor networks due to its high performance and peripheral set.
- Automotive Systems: Used in automotive applications such as body control modules, infotainment systems, and advanced driver-assistance systems (ADAS).
- IoT Devices: Ideal for IoT applications requiring low power consumption and high performance, such as smart home devices, wearables, and industrial IoT nodes.
- Medical Devices: Can be used in medical devices that require precise control and low power consumption, such as portable medical equipment and health monitoring devices.
Q & A
- What is the core type of the MKV30F128VLH10 microcontroller?
The core type is Arm Cortex-M4.
- What is the maximum operating frequency of the MKV30F128VLH10?
The maximum operating frequency is 100 MHz.
- How much flash memory does the MKV30F128VLH10 have?
The MKV30F128VLH10 has 128 KB of flash memory.
- What is the package type of the MKV30F128VLH10?
The package type is 64-LQFP (10x10x1.6mm).
- What is the supply voltage range for the MKV30F128VLH10?
The supply voltage range is 1.71V to 3.6V.
- What are some of the key peripherals available on the MKV30F128VLH10?
The key peripherals include DMA, PWM, WDT, I²C, SPI, UART/USART, and SAR ADCs.
- What is the operating temperature range for the MKV30F128VLH10?
The operating temperature range is -40°C to 105°C.
- Is the MKV30F128VLH10 suitable for low power applications?
Yes, it is designed with low power consumption in mind, making it suitable for battery-powered devices.
- What are some common applications for the MKV30F128VLH10?
Common applications include industrial automation, automotive systems, IoT devices, and medical devices.
- Does the MKV30F128VLH10 support floating-point operations?
Yes, it includes a floating-point unit (FPU) as part of the Arm Cortex-M4 core.